This paper aims to estimate effect of elastic wall of blood vessel in the numerical simulation of blood flow. In order to future the internal carotid artery, the curved pipe model was used. The study was conducted using two different types of wall condition: 1) rigid wall, and 2) elastic wall. Instantaneous wall shear stress distributions and velocity distributions are compared between both cases. As a result, distributions and the maximum magnitude of wall shear stress are not different in both cases. The flow field is also similar and deformation of the wall is very small.
